Manila, June 15 -- President Ferdinand R. Marcos Jr. has called on Congress to convene in a special session on June 17 to act on priority measures aimed at strengthening social protection, education, healthcare and to ensure urgent government responses to the needs of Filipinos amid ongoing challenges, including the recent Mindanao earthquake.

Marcos signed and issued Monday Proclamation No. 1318, directing lawmakers to consider several pending bills that have reached advanced stages in the legislative process but remain unfinished.

The President said urgent action is needed amid ongoing energy challenges and the recovery efforts following the recent magnitude 7.8 earthquake that struck parts of Mindanao.
